The ‘Untimely Meditations, ‘ or ‘Thoughts out of Season, ‘ is a compilation of four pieces written by noted philosopher Friedrich Nietzsche between 1873 and 1876. In the first article ‘David Strauss: the Confessor and the Writer’, Nietzsche challenges David Strauss’ ‘The Old and the New Faith: A Confession’. Nietzsche provides an alternative method of understanding history in his second essay, ‘On the Use and Abuse of History for Living, ‘ in which experiencing life becomes the major goal. In the third article, ‘Schopenhauer as Educator, ‘ Nietzsche discusses how Schopenhauer’s intellectual talent may lead to a revival of German culture. In the fourth and last essay, ‘Richard Wagner in Bayreuth, ‘ Nietzsche explores Richard Wagner’s music, drama, and personality.
